Dive Maldives is the detailed guide to diving the atolls of the Maldives Archipelago with information on over 350 dive sites based on the author's personal research over 25 years. Updated in 2023.
A complete reference book of sharks, rays and fishes for researchers, divers and snorkellers. Contains 1124 colour photographs of almost every fish likely to be seen by divers.
The Maldives Field Fish Guide features the Top 200+ species of sharks, rays and fishes of the Maldives. Includes a silhouette of each fish for easy identification, details including depth range, size, distribution, IUCN Red List status, page reference to the book and a checkbox for recording species.
A detailed fold-out map of the 868 km (539 miles) long archipelago showing the atolls, location of the resorts, as well as the other features, such as protected marine areas, airports and guest house islands. The reverse side features 12 sharks and rays, and 83 common fish species from the book Fishes of the Maldives: Indian Ocean.
